I have a table with 500 rows and 8 columns. The decimal separation is comma (,). However I would like to convert the separation to point(.)
Is it possible to do this without having to loop through the entire table?
Is there any function that permits conversion (something similar to strrep) when working with tables?

Table.VarName = str2double(regexprep(Table.VarName,',','.'));
It works on Matlab 2020b

t.Var=str2double(strrep(t.Var,',','.');
for affected each variable 'Var' in table 't'.
Can generalize into loop or use whatever is most convenient addressing depending on structure of the table, just ensure the form used returns the variable content of the column not another table. See the
doc table % section on addressing for details

TheTable{:, ColumnNumber} = str2double( regexprep(TheTable{:,ColumnNumber}, ',', '.') );
